Mostrar Contenido / Índice / Búsqueda

Cuadro de diálogo Configurar API y seguridad de macros

Cómo llegar

En este cuadro de diálogo, se puede habilitar la API Reflection .NET y especificar el tipo de canal y los parámetros correspondientes.

Nota: use diseños si desea utilizar simultáneamente la API en varias instancias de Reflection. Puede especificar diferentes valores de Nombre de canal IPC y Puerto API para cada diseño en el cuadro de diálogo Parámetros de diseño.

Parámetros API*

 

Desactivar API

Seleccione esta opción para evitar que las aplicaciones personalizadas accedan a esta instalación de Reflection.

 

Utilizar IPC

Seleccione esta opción para que las aplicaciones personalizadas tengan acceso a la API a través del canal IPC (Inter-Process Communication).

 

Utilizar TCP/IP

Seleccione esta opción para que las aplicaciones personalizadas tengan acceso a la API a través del canal TCP/IP.

Advertencia: si selecciona esta opción, seleccione Acceso seguro para reducir los riesgos de seguridad.

 

 

Puerto API

Especifique el puerto (número) que desea utilizar.

 

 

Permitir acceso remoto

Seleccione esta opción para que las aplicaciones personalizadas que se están ejecutando en otras computadoras tengan acceso a la API.

Advertencia: si selecciona esta opción, seleccione Acceso seguro para reducir los riesgos de seguridad.

 

 

Acceso seguro

Seleccione esta opción para cifrar, firmar y autenticar la información que se intercambia entre una aplicación personalizada y la API cuando se utiliza TCP/IP.

Si selecciona esta opción, puede especificar las credenciales para la autenticación. Seleccione Autenticar mediante credencial de dominio para que el acceso a la API se realice mediante sus credenciales de dominio (cualquiera que disponga de una cuenta en el dominio podrá acceder a la API de Reflection). Seleccione Autenticar mediante credencial local (el usuario y la contraseña de la cuenta local de Windows) para controlar el acceso a través de las cuentas de su computadora. Una ventaja de esta opción es que puede trabajar con la API incluso si no existe ningún dominio.

 

Preferencia de API heredada

Seleccione esta opción para especificar si se admiten las macros heredadas de Reflection y determinar qué API heredada tiene preferencia para el método GetObject() que se usa para recuperar los objetos COM de las API. Reflection admite múltiples API, pero únicamente acepta llamadas GetObject() para un tipo de objeto API heredado a la vez.

 

Seleccione

Si

 

 

Ninguna API heredada

No usa macros heredadas de Reflection o si el código no usa GetObject() para acceder a los objetos COM de las API heredadas.

 

 

Reflection

Usa macros heredadas de Reflection o usa GetObject() para acceder a los objetos COM de las API heredadas de Reflection. Todos los documentos de sesión que abra o cree con posterioridad serán compatibles con las macros heredadas; en el Editor de Visual Basic se incluye un proyecto VBA heredado además del proyecto VBA estándar.

Nota: el soporte la las API de productos heredados está presente en todos los archivos de configuración de Reflection abiertos en el espacio de trabajo (incluidos los archivos de configuración guardados como documentos de sesión de Reflection), independientemente de si se selecciona esta opción.

 

 

EXTRA!

Utiliza GetObject() para acceder a los objetos COM de las API del EXTRA! heredado.

Permisos de acciones

Especifique lo que desea que suceda al iniciar una acción, que se ha restringido utilizando una Política de grupo o el Administrador de permisos, mediante una llamada a una macro o API.

Solicitar derechos de administración en Vista; no ejecutar en XP

En una computadora con Windows Vista, seleccione esta opción para controlar las acciones restringidas con el UAC (Control de cuentas de usuario).

o bien,

En una computadora con Windows XP, seleccione esta opción para impedir la ejecución de las acciones restringidas.

 

Ejecutar la acción

Seleccione esta opción para ejecutar normalmente las acciones restringidas iniciadas por una llamada a una macro o API. No se iniciarán dichas acciones si se ejecutan desde la interfaz de usuario.

Temas relacionados

Cuadro de diálogo Parámetros de diseño

Uso de diseños

Información de seguridad para usuarios finales